Description
Emile Vanhonsebrouck and his wife Louise De Poorter founded the Sint Jozef brewery in Ingelmunster. In 1922 the brothers Paul and Ernest Van Honsebrouck take over the brewery from their mother. In 1953 Luc Van Honsebrouck (son of Paul) becomes director. Luc realizes that the small Sint Jozef brewery isn't able to compete with the large pils breweries. He therefore decides to concentrate on the production of an old brown beer, naming it Bacchus, and he changes the name of the brewery to Vanhonsebrouck. The St-Louis Gueuze and Kriek were officially launched in 1958. In 2009 Xavier Vanhonsebrouck succeeds his father Luc. In 2016 the doors of the old brewery in Ingelmunster are permanently closed. The new site in Emelgem is now home to a brand new, fully integrated brewery, with the equipment to produce all of the Vanhonsebrouck beers. In the meantime Kasteel Brouwerij Vanhonsebrouck becomes the new official name.

Review based on the BJCP2021 guidelines (style 26D adapted - aged). Bottle 33 cl - Batch KACU0911A 04:28 (BB: 09-2029) AROMA: initial medium-high boozy aroma (rose-like, almost solventy) with low background notes of candied fruits, molasses and sultanas. APPEARANCE: very dark amber color and clear with ruby highlights. medium-large light brown head, creamy, with good retention. lace formation. TASTE: medium malty flavor with notes of dark caramel, almost molasses and hints of dried fruits and some toastiness. medium-low bitterness with a dry finish. MOUTHFEEL: medium to medium-low body due to aging. medium carbonation. noticeable alcoholic warmth. OVERALL: an aged belgian dark strong ale with interesting aroma but a more muted flavor. alcohol is still very much present.

Review based on the BJCP2021 guidelines (style 26C). Bottle 33 cl - Batch KATR0903C 18:13 (BB: 09-2027) AROMA: medium-high esteres (lemony-like, pear), with a medium-low phenolics (peppery, slight clove). medium-low to low soft malt background with slight sweetness. APPEARANCE: gold color and clear. medium-large white head, creamy, with medium-low retention. slight lace formation. TASTE: similar to the aroma with medium-low esters (lemon, pear), low phenolics (clove-like), and low soft malt background. medium bitterness with a dry finish. MOUTHFEEL: medium body with high carbonation. noticeable alcoholic warmth sensation with a hot character. OVERALL: a regular belgian tripel.
